1. Discover Todos Santos’ Vibrant Art Scene
One of the highlights of a Todos Santos travel itinerary is definitely its vibrant art scene. This charming town is renowned for its artistic culture and creativity, evidenced by the numerous galleries and studios showcasing local talent. Begin your day by exploring the many art galleries along Calle Juárez. Each gallery offers a unique perspective on life in Todos Santos, emphasizing the colors and landscapes of Baja California.
Moreover, visiting the Casa de la Cultura is a must. This cultural center often features exhibitions from local artists, and you can even participate in workshops. If you’re lucky, you might catch an art walk event, where you can meet artists and enjoy live music in a lively atmosphere.
In addition to galleries, street art is prominent in Todos Santos. As you walk through the town, take a moment to appreciate the colorful murals that depict the region’s rich culture and history. These artworks not only beautify the streets but also offer insight into the life of the locals.

2. Relax on the Stunning Beaches of Todos Santos
After immersing yourself in the local art, it’s time to unwind on the stunning beaches of Todos Santos. One of the most acclaimed beaches is Playa Cerritos, known for its soft sands and gentle surf. Here, you can relax under the sun or take part in surfing lessons, as the waves are suitable for all skill levels.
On the other hand, if you’re seeking tranquility, Playa La Cachora offers a more secluded setting. This picturesque beach is perfect for picnics or simply enjoying a quiet moment listening to the waves. However, be sure to bring your own supplies, as amenities are limited here.
Additionally, the coastline of Todos Santos is dotted with stunning vistas and rocky outcrops, making it an ideal backdrop for photography. Explore tide pools during low tide, where you can discover a variety of marine life. Moreover, don’t forget to catch the sunset at the beach; the display of colors is truly breathtaking.

3. Savor Local Cuisine at Top Restaurants
Your culinary journey in Todos Santos will be nothing short of extraordinary. This charming town offers a rich tapestry of flavors that is sure to delight every palate. Begin your gastronomic adventure at Tequila’s Sunrise, popular for its innovative cocktails and fresh seafood. Here, make sure to try their signature shrimp tacos, which have received rave reviews from both locals and tourists alike.
Furthermore, do not miss out on La Copa Cocina, a restaurant renowned for its farm-to-table approach. Their menu changes seasonally, enabling you to experience the freshest ingredients available. As a result, each visit promises a new culinary delight, whether it’s their handmade pasta or the meticulously crafted vegan options.
Pro tip: Be sure to indulge in traditional Baja fish tacos from local street vendors for an authentic taste!
Additionally, make a reservation at Jazamango, an exquisite eatery by local celebrity chef Jair Tellez. It beautifully combines old-world Mexican flavors with modern techniques. Dining here is not only about the food but also the atmosphere. The lush gardens wrapping the restaurant enhance the overall dining experience.
Finally, bring your meal to a sweet close with dessert from La Esquina. Their homemade paletas (Mexican popsicles) come in a variety of exotic flavors, making it a perfect treat after a hearty meal. If you are seeking adventure during your Todos Santos Travel Itinerary, you’re in for a treat. The area is known for its stunning natural beauty and diverse outdoor activities. One popular choice is surfing; the beaches here, especially Los Cerritos, are hailed as one of the best surfing spots in the region. Whether you are a seasoned pro or a beginner, there are surf schools available offering lessons and rentals.
Moreover, hiking enthusiasts will find solace in the scenic trails surrounding Todos Santos. The Sierra de la Laguna mountains provide numerous options for hiking. The Los Cabos Biosphere Reserve is a must-visit for those who cherish nature. You can explore trails that lead to breathtaking views and diverse wildlife.
For a more relaxed adventure, kayaking or paddleboarding along the coastline can be incredibly rewarding. You’ll have the chance to encounter marine life, including dolphins and sea turtles. Rent equipment from local shops that offer great deals on rentals.
Pro tip: Check the local tides before heading out, as they can affect your kayaking experience!
Lastly, don’t miss out on an evening of whale watching during the migratory season (December to April). The thrill of seeing these majestic creatures in their natural habitat can be a highlight of your trip. Such diverse outdoor activities ensure that Todos Santos caters to every type of adventurer!
5. Cultural Delights: History and Heritage of Todos Santos
Understanding the history and heritage of Todos Santos adds a profound layer to your travel experience. Originally founded as a mission in 1724, this charming town has retained its rich cultural essence. Therefore, walking through its cobblestone streets is like taking a step back in time.
One must-visit location is the Mission of Nuestra Señora del Pilar, an architectural gem that showcases the town’s historical significance. This church, built in the 18th century, features stunning artwork and offers a glimpse into the religious practices and community spirit of the local people. Moreover, its serene courtyard invites visitors to reflect on Todos Santos’ storied past.
In addition to the church, the town is home to several cultural festivals that celebrate its traditions. For instance, the Todos Santos Music Festival held every January brings together local talent and international artists, showcasing a fusion of music and culture. Furthermore, the traditional Día de los Muertos celebrations every November reflect the Mexican customs of honoring ancestors with colorful altars and processions.
Moreover, you can explore the local museums, such as the Casa de la Cultura, where exhibitions highlight the region’s artisans and their crafts. This provides a wonderful opportunity to purchase unique handcrafted items as souvenirs while supporting the community.
